Questo stupido metodo, mi da un fatal error su mac mentre passa su windows

Codice PHP:
//il metodo calcola il numero dei giorni del mese per l'anno considerato
  
private function GetNumeroGiorniMese($mese$anno){
    
$numero_giorni cal_days_in_month(CAL_GREGORIAN$mese$anno);
    
    return 
$numero_giorni;
    
  } 
Fatal error: Call to undefined function cal_days_in_month() in /Library/WebServer/Documents/ergon.dev/public_html/include/class/class.calendario.php on line 118

Ho appena scoperto che su mac php non è stato compilato con --enable-calendar. Qualcuno mi sa spiegare come si fa a ricompilarlo? Non ho mai fatto un'operazione del genere...

Grazie